This mod replaces all of the vampire lords with the female vampire agents (All Variants) on the campaign map and in battles. This also replaces the battlefield voices but the campaign voice is still male (I've been having trouble finding the right file to fix that)

The mounted models have also been swaped but unfortunately the female vampire does not have a dragon so I swaped the dragon model with the hellsteed (Only for the female lords)

Flaws so far:
1) On existing campaign saves voices are vampire male so a new game is required for female voices on the campaign map (Only for recruited lords)
2) Default campaign names are male (So you will have to rename them manually)
3) When mounted on dragons there are some physics issues with the character model
4) The ruler of Mousillon is a female

I think I found a workaround for this mod's compatibility issue with Radious. Enable Radious first without this mod enabled and start game. Once you get to main menu, exit the game. Enable this mod (I believe doing this gives this mod priority over the mods enabled before i.e. Radious) and it should work. I tried it myself just now and it seems to work. Haven't tested at length but from what I can see they seem to work together after doing this. From turn 1, buildings have the Radious changes on them. Tried a campaign battle also and the model was intact (didn't have the weird jaw, sword being in wrong place, male voice, etc). I haven't tested at length so don't take my word for it though.
